The people of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K) are united by a singular mission: ending cancer for life. Our specialized care teams provide personalized, compassionate, expert care to patients of all ages. Informed by basic research done at our Sloan Kettering Institute, scientists across MSK collaborate to conduct innovative translational and clinical research that is driving a revolution in our understanding of cancer as a disease and improving the ability to prevent, diagnose, and treat it. MSK is dedicated to training the next generation of scientists and clinicians, who go on to pursue our mission at MSK and around the globe. One of the world’s most respected comprehensive centers devoted exclusively to cancer, we have been recognized as one of the top two cancer hospitals in the country by U.S. News & World Report for more than 30 years.

Job Description:
We Are:
 

Seeking a curious, results-driven talent champion for the Manager, Workforce Programs role.
 

Reporting to the Director, Talent Acquisition/Candidate Experience, you’ll play a meaningful role in supporting the MSK talent strategy, connecting individuals to career pathways and job opportunities. In this role, you’ll design and deliver an inclusive talent approach that supports the institution's workforce goals.
 

You Are:
  • An innovative thinker with flexibility in a continuously evolving environment
  • Adaptable, solution-oriented, and enthusiastic about delivering results
  • Curious and able to accept ambiguity to achieve goals aligned to institutional strategy
  • Thoughtful and data-focused with the ability analyze metrics, showcase progress and drive innovation
  • Highly autonomous and eager to make an impact
  • An effective communicator, capable of determining how best to reach different audiences and executing communications based on that understanding
  • Willing to take action and eager to accept new opportunities and tough challenges with high energy, and passion
You Will:
  • Oversee the day-to-day program planning and execution, including developing market research and project plans, and facilitating alignment, progress, and communication
  • Be responsible for management, day-to-day operations, and overall experience to drive awareness of career programs including career pipeline and scholars, pathways, and current job opportunities aligned to MSK’s workforce needs
  • Ensure appropriate resources are available to support our workforce as they navigate their career at MSK, creating a straightforward, inclusive experience that meets employees where they are in their journey
  • Provide system administration for Career Hub (Eightfold.ai) and subject matter expertise for talent programs, including management of communications to support workforce initiatives
  • Collaborate within and outside Human Resources to provide support to meet institutional, departmental, divisional, and unit-based goals.
  • Be flexible and self-starting in your approach, serving as the project lead for new workforce initiatives based on changing talent landscape
  • Use high judgment and a data-driven approach including external market data to inform the path forward and support the institutional talent strategy
You Need:
  • 5-7 years of professional work experience that includes program management and workforce development
  • Project management and experience working in a complex and ambiguous environment
  • Familiarity with HR Technology systems (Eightfold or similar, iCIMS, Workday, Tableau)
  • Proven ability to utilize data to drive recommendations and present visually
